COMMANDO KIDS—Above, YMCA campers crawl under a camouflage net as part of an obstacle course during “Character Kids Challenge,” the Y’s end-of-summer event on Aug. 26 at Rancho Santa Susana Community Park in Simi Valley. At left, Vanessa Velasco, 7, of Chatsworth carries a cup full of water during a relay race. More than 500 campers concluded their summer program with a full day of games, costume drama and songs focusing on the six pillars of character they learned about all summer—trustworthiness, respect, responsibility, fairness, caring and citizenship.
